--------------- libgee-0.8 (0.10.1-1) unstable; urgency=low [ Andreas Henriksson ] * Team upload. * Imported Upstream version 0.10.1 * Update symbols file, multiple added and two missing. [ Michael Biebl ] * Rename the source package to libgee-0.8 so it can co-exist with 0.6. * Build-Depend on valac (>= 0.18) instead of valac-0.18. * Bump Build-Depends on libglib2.0-dev to (>= 2.32). * Bump Standards-Version to 3.9.4. No further changes. * Drop the shlibs version and simply use -V instead as we are using symbols files and the existing version was outdated anyway. Fix the regex to get the library package name while at it. * Don't hard code the valac version in debian/rules. * The targeted glib version is set in configure via GLIB_REQUIRED.
